I have a print server with 2 print queues, and with a GPO using Deploy with Group Policy it adds it to the users

I am migrating the server to a print server2019.

I created the same queue. I shared it, same user permissions, I went to the GPO and removed the objects that pointed to the old server and created the same but pointed to the new server.

But already replicated in all the DC, (it's been more than a day now) in the workstations they still see the old queue. and it doesn't install the new printer either.

I found that in the GPO report:

there is an error in deployed printer connections:

"it is possible that additional information has been registered. check in the policy tab" .. where is that? did anyone happen to it?

I can't understand what configuration is wrong.
